2024-02-09 08:30:00 Who is the “King of Critical Moments” in the NBA this season? According to NBA official website data, Golden State Warriors star Stephen Curry has scored 152 points at critical moments this season, and his efficiency is also very high. There is no doubt that he is the best player during this period. But the paradox is that with Curry’s good performance, the Warriors’ performance at critical moments this season has been unsatisfactory, which has become an important reason why their winning rate before the star game is less than 50%.

According to NBA official figures, the Warriors have had 34 games this season that have been decided by critical moments (officially defined as games with a score difference of less than 5 points in the last 5 minutes of the game), and their record is 16 wins and 18 losses. Not more than 50%. The team averages only 8.8 points and their field goal percentage is 43.9, which is not ideal. This is why they are currently in the quagmire. ▲Stephen Curry has scored 152 points at critical moments this season, shooting 51.6% from the field, 49.1% from three-point range, and averaging 62.3 points per 100 possessions. (Photo/AP/Dazhi Image) Despite this, the team’s sluggish performance still cannot deny Curry’s outstanding performance at critical moments this season.As of February 6, heSo far in the 2023-24 season, at the age of 35, he has scored 152 points at critical moments, shooting 51.6% from the field and 49.1% from three-point range. He averages 62.3 points per 100 possessions, which is at least the most experienced in the league. No. 1 among players with more than 10 clutch games.Curry’s terrible statistics at critical moments don’t end there. His three-point shooting percentage this season is as high as 49.1%, ranking sixth among players who have taken at least 10 three-pointers at critical moments, but he is also the only one who has taken more than 30 three-pointers. player – in fact, he has taken as many as 53 three-pointers at critical moments this season and hit 26 of them. ▲Stephen Curry is alone, and the Golden State Warriors have lost many games in which he has performed well this season. (Photo/AP/Dazhi Image) It’s just that Curry’s performance failed to win the Warriors’ victory, which shows that the Bay Area did not give him enough help this season. With Klay Thompson regressing and J.Kuminga still lacking experience, Curry can only shoulder the team’s scoring burden alone at critical moments.The Warriors are currentlyCompared with scoring, defense may be a bigger headache for them, because this team’s defensive efficiency is 118.1 this season, ranking 22nd in the league.During the dynasty, the Warriors were not only very efficient on the offensive end, but their excellent defense was the key to their ability to dominate the league. With Draymond Green back, this team needs to improve in this area in the second half of the season. If they can lower the tempo and play high-intensity defense at critical moments, then using Curry’s offensive performance this season, they will have a chance to improve their winning rate and return to the playoffs.
